Reliable C, with Data Structures
This book, copyright 1985, reveals the hidden underbelly of the C language -- the Standard Library .H files, why they are there, what they are for, and how to use them reliably. It does this so the reader can know what functions are already in the standard library, so the reader doesn't have to recreate them.

The book's central theme is Reliablity -- "No Suprises". To reach this goal it covers all the side effects different C useage has -- and presents a set of rules to standardize on reliable use of C.

I wish I'd found this book 15 years or so. It answers those irritating questions like "Okay, how SHOULD I write a C macro so it's SAFE?". Buy any beginning C language book, but this one is highly recommended as THE second C book you should own.
